Madison Booker usually doesn’t hunt her shots like she did today, but she showed when she is aggressive, she can tote the backpack for the Texas Longhorns as she put up a career-high 40 points in the 100-58 win over Oregon to advance to the Sweet 16.

Texas (33-3) ran its home win streak to 44. A No. 1 seed for the third year in a row, the Longhorns now head to Fort Worth in a bid to return to the Final Four for the second consecutive season. They will play the winner of Monday’s matchup between No. 4 West Virginia (28-6) and No. 5 Kentucky (24-10).
Katie Fiso scored 16 points to lead Oregon (23-13), which last made the Sweet 16 in 2021.
